This research is qualitative research with the main aim to describe or describe in detail and in depth the process of implementing village funds so that they can provide a role/contribution as expected by the central government. The technique used in this research is a qualitative descriptive technique. Qualitative descriptive means collecting existing data, then interpreting and describing the data relating to the situation that is occurring and then connecting it to the problem that is occurring. From the research results, the processing of village funds in Bencah Kelubi Village, Tapung District, Kampar Regency was carried out based on existing technical instructions so that community empowerment from 2015 to 2017 began to increase in terms of development, but there was still minimal improvement in community economic empowerment. The policies implemented by the government in carrying out its duties are benchmarked against the basic values of Islamic economics, namely: ownership, balance and justice. The government collaborates with institutions in the village, and the decisions taken by the government are joint decisions in the Village Development Plan Deliberation (Musrenbangdes).
